My client is a leading multinational company and they are seeking for a Finance Transformation Analyst to support their ongoing finance transformation and ERP readiness initiatives.

This role will focus on preparing multiple country entities for future ERP implementation, driving process standardisation, improving data quality, and supporting operational improvements across the finance function. The successful candidate will help streamline processes, document workflows, and ensure a smooth transition when new systems are rolled out.

Key Responsibilities

Assess finance processes across different country entities to ensure readiness for ERP implementation.

Identify gaps, recommend improvements, and support process standardisation initiatives.

Prepare and maintain process documentation, SOPs, and data mapping for future system configuration.

Support operational improvements in month-end closing, reporting, and internal controls.

Facilitate knowledge transfer, training, and coordination between finance teams and ERP project teams.

Track readiness metrics and support post-implementation activities to ensure smooth adoption.

Requirements

3-5 years of finance or accounting experience, preferably with exposure to process improvement or ERP-related projects.

Strong understanding of core finance processes (GL, AP, AR, Fixed Assets, revenue recognition, consolidations).

Analytical, detail-oriented, and able to work independently in a project-driven environment.

Excellent documentation and communication skills; able to liaise with multiple stakeholders.

Degree in Accounting, Finance, or a related discipline; professional accounting certification preferred but not essential.

Familiarity with ERP systems (NetSuite advantageous) and process mapping tools.
